Born in Tiflis, Georgia (1984) in the musicians' family. He became a pupil of prof. Olga Voitova at the Munich Conservatory when he was 9 and was accepted as a student there in 1997. In 2002 he continued his studies with prof. Victor Tretjakov at the Cologne Music Academy. During this time he also attended the master classes of Alexander Brussilovsky (Geneva) and Felix Andrievsky (London).
-
Laureate of several «Judent musiziert» national youth competitions: 1st prizes.
-
Obtained diploma at the Louis Spohr international violin competition in Weimar (1999).
